Key Buying Factors for a Disposable Pedicure Tool Kit

Tool Mix

Look at whether the kit includes only finishing tools or a more complete set. A nail file and buffer handle basic prep, while a pumice pad helps with rough skin and callus smoothing. Toe separators and wood sticks add convenience during polish application and cleanup.

Grit and Texture

File grit matters. Medium grits are usually more versatile for shaping and smoothing, while finer buffers are better for finishing. If you want a Disposable Pedicure Tool Kit for mixed-use salon services, choose a set with balanced grit levels rather than overly abrasive options.

Packaging and Hygiene

Individually wrapped kits are ideal in professional environments because they reduce handling and make sanitation routines easier. Bulk-packed kits can still work well for home use or back-of-house prep, but packaging should remain clean, organized, and easy to dispense.

Value Per Service

Don’t judge only by total piece count. A larger kit may be a better value if it includes the tools you actually use, while a smaller kit can be smarter if it reduces waste and keeps inventory simple.

Who Should Buy Which Disposable Pedicure Tool Kit?

Salon and spa professionals should lean toward individually packed 4-piece or 5-piece kits for hygiene and workflow efficiency. At-home users may prefer simpler kits if they only need light nail shaping and basic foot care. If rough heels or calluses are your main concern, choose a kit with a pumice pad or foot scrubber. If polish prep is the priority, focus on sets with a good file, buffer, and toe separator.

In short, the best Disposable Pedicure Tool Kit is the one that matches your service style, hygiene standards, and how often you’ll use it.
